Overview
The Gazelle Medeo T9 HMB is a Class 1 mid-drive urban commuter e-bike engineered with a Bosch Active Line Plus motor and a 400Wh frame-integrated battery. Built in the Netherlands, it combines traditional Dutch step-through geometry with modern mid-drive motor telemetry.
Motor & Drivetrain Telemetry
Driven by a 250W sustained Bosch Active Line Plus mid-drive motor delivering 50 Nm of torque. Power transfer is regulated by Bosch’s triple-sensor system (measuring torque, cadence, and wheel speed 1,000 times per second) paired with a Shimano Acera 9-speed cassette.
Frame & Safety Certifications
Constructed from 6061 aluminum alloy with an integrated rear rack, MIK click system, chain guard, and integrated AXA LED lighting powered by the main battery pack. The full electrical architecture and battery system are certified to UL 2849 standards via Bosch Smart System protocols.
